After reading negative reviews, I was a little skeptical of this purchase. Before installing it, I ensured all the bolts on the derby cover glass were sufficiently tight. I've had zero problems after at least 1000 miles. Very happy with the buy.9/24/20 Update - The best part about this derby cover is that I can monitor the primary fluid without having to take it off. Considering the issue with fluid transfer on the Harley M8s, this is a big plus. Unfortunately, I have to walk back my enthusiasm for this product after I started noticing leaks. I tried taking it off and giving it a thorough cleaning. I also made sure to use Loctite on all the screws, including the little window screws, but after one ride, it's leaking again - although not as badly so far. I did notice that the window gaskets started breaking down. I wonder if that's the weak link causing the leaking. Also, the finish started peeling off on the inside of the cover, but not where it could get into the engine since it's well outside the derby gasket. There is a chance that fluid transfer from the tranny to the primary is factor in all this. Right now I'm trying to figure out next steps.12/30/20 Update - ALL my problems with leaking disappeared once I installed the Harley vent kit (part# 26500027) to solve the fluid transfer problem on my M8 Street Glide. After dealing with leaking primary fluid for sometime, I finally discovered that excess pressure in the primary was what was driving the leaking. I've had no primary fluid leakage with this derby cover since installing the vent kit. Reference HD Service Bulletin M1492 for more information about this issue. Apologies to the seller for assuming the problem was the derby cover.
